Optimism has rolled out a significant update with the release of opbatcher v1.17.0, which is essential for operators utilizing the batching infrastructure for OP Stack chains. As stated in the official source, this upgrade comes with crucial enhancements aimed at improving functionality and security.

Compatibility Adjustments for Ethereum's Glamsterdam Upgrade

The new version includes compatibility adjustments for Ethereum's upcoming Glamsterdam upgrade, ensuring that operators can seamlessly integrate with the latest network changes. Additionally, the update introduces important security modifications to bolster the overall safety of the batching process.

Configurable Limits for Alternative Data Availability

Operators are also provided with configurable limits regarding alternative data availability, allowing for greater flexibility in managing transaction data. It is imperative for all operators to upgrade to opbatcher v1.17.0 to continue effectively publishing transaction data and to stay aligned with the evolving Ethereum ecosystem.
